What is Angular, and how is it different from AngularJS?

ngular is a TypeScript-based open-source front-end web application framework

developed by Google for building single-page applications (SPAs).

Key Differences:

Feature AngularJS (v1.x) Angular (2+)

Language JavaScript TypeScript

rchitecture MVC (Model-View-Controller) Component-based

Mobile Support No Yes

Performance Slower due to two-way binding Faster with unidirectional data

flow

Dependency

Injection

Limited Robust and built-in

Real-Time Example:

  • AngularJS was used in legacy projects (e.g., dashboards in older admin panels).
  • Angular is used in modern SPAs like Google Ads, Gmail, Netflix dashboards, etc.
